Has God Rejected His People?

But you may ask, 'Didn’t God reject the Jews because of their disobedience?' I am glad you asked. Some had asked this same question of the Apostle Paul, and the answer was unequivocal: “GOD Forbid!” (Romans 11:1). Indeed, the 11th chapter of Romans is Paul’s treatise on the role and future of Israel in God’s plan of redemption. Rather than teaching replacement theology, the Apostle Paul reasserts what was the clear teaching of the Old Testament. God is not through with Israel, and He has a grand plan for their future.


To summarize Romans 11, Paul tells us that God has not finally rejected His people, Israel. Rather, because of their disobedience, God has given them a “spirit of stupor”, a “partial hardening”. They have been broken off from the root, but will be grafted in again. During this time of Israel’s blindness, the gospel has gone to the Gentiles in order to make the Jews jealous. We Gentiles, the wild olive tree, have been grafted in to the root of the natural olive tree (Israel). Once the “fullness of the Gentiles” has come in (to salvation), then “all Israel will be saved.” Regarding Israel, Paul states, “For the gifts and calling of God are without repentance” (Romans 11:29). That is, God’s covenant with Israel in the Old Testament has not been revoked. Israel will inherit the blessings promised to them and one day in the future they will be grafted back in and “all Israel will be saved”.


Paul is merely repeating what God had already said in the Old Testament. He has promised to never cast off Israel (Jeremiah 31:35-37).


Salvation of Israel


Throughout the Old Testament God promised that one day salvation would come to Israel (Jeremiah 31:31-34; Ezekiel 36:24-28, 37:21-28; Hosea 3:4,5; Joel 3:16-21; Zechariah 10:6-12, 12:10). Though they had rebelled and sinned against God, He would one day have compassion on them to salvation. Paul knew the scriptures and this is what he is speaking of in Romans 11.
